Which statement correctly describes penetrating x-rays?

Explanation:
Penetrating power increases with photon energy. Since energy is inversely related to wavelength (E = hc/λ), shorter wavelengths carry more energy and pass through tissues more readily. That makes the most penetrating x-rays the ones with short wavelengths. Longer wavelengths have less energy and are absorbed or scattered more easily, and intermediate wavelengths don’t maximize penetration. So the statement that the most penetrating x-rays travel in short wavelengths is correct.
